I've been absent for a while (big project!) but I just got back from a cruise and my hair just loved it! I washed it 4 times in 7 days (I normally wash 8-10 day stretches) and I'd braid and soak it with cone free condish. When it dried (over night or just later in the day) this is what I got! Shiny and soft!

https://farm9.staticflickr.com/8695/16662967419_455bd5f386.jpg (https://flic.kr/p/ros4FH)

I used my same shampoo (cheapo white rain) but I'm wondering if my hair liked the water. I have hard (well water) at home and the ship water is de-salinated (de-salted??) seawater. I know it wasn't the humidity or proximity to the ocean (live in Florida) so I'm betting it just really liked the water! Must cruise often!

Anyone else have good/unexpected results when traveling?

Firstly, your hair is absolutely stunning!

Secondly, I'd have to say that the difference in water is definitely a factor in your hair being so much happier during your cruise. Hard water is, to put it as mildly as possible, torture on hair and as a fellow hard water sufferer, I've also noticed an improvement when I've had the luxury of washing my hair in other types of water. I actually have a tendency of washing my hair in bath water - I use super moisturizing bath bars from Lush and my water feels amazingly soft, so I figured it would equally benefit my hair!

I also live in a hard water area. It's terrible on hair. I've started doing my finally rinse with filtered water and it helps quite a bit, though it's not the same as when I was vacationing in San Diego. The water is so nice and soft there. I didn't recognize my hair!
